During March there were some warm sunny days and Dawns with lovely light.
All through winter ups and downs, GGH had Hellebores and Polyanthus.
Approaching Spring, in March, brought out Primroses, Hyacinths and Kerria …
… also delightful Elephants’ Ears, … Bergenia.
Shoots, from the trunk on which the old cherry tree were grafted, have flowered up in the Privet, and along with a variety of daffodils the Tulip buds of March are now flowering. Predominant colours amongst the vivid greens, are yellows, pinks and blues.
Blue Hill is resplendent with Myosotis, which didn’t forget to flourish!
Grape Hyacinths, when not flattened by the marauding cats, are cute!
Birds and Squirrels are returning, along with a mass of Spanish Bluebells!
It’s cold today, but Spring has arrived and am watering GGH again!.
